We had one in our family.Same colour but saloon.GPJ 289N if youre still out there,do something I dunno.......honky!!
This had the obligatory black vinyl and BMW-style shaped dash around the driver.It rotted out like some old Capri in yer front garden on bricks might! Plastic Padding ahoy,and we sold it 3 years later for the £1200 we paid for it in 1974. These went quite well and were light,and of course RWD! They out-reliabled the Brit cars of the time,I remember,and such good value. Nice spot matey! Steve

Shame you've not got a 260z or 240z they'll make good money now... On the run up to buying my GT (in 1990) I test drove several 240 and 260z's along with a few Audi Coupe GT's, because I was driving 35 miles each way to work I settled for the 2.2i KE engined GT, the 240/260z being a bit questionable for reliability. In 2000 when I parted company (due to accident damage) with my GT it was proably worth, in open market, £600.00 and a similar condition 240z would have fetched £4-6k.
